How does a solar hat work?

The flexible solar panel captures sunlight as you go about your day, and the energy flows through to the USB-C port inside the hat's band. You plug in, stash your device in a backpack or pocket, and let the sun do the rest. There's no app, no settings, just solar power straight to your phone.

How does a power hat work?

At first glance, the Power Hat looks like your average wide-brimmed sun hat, the kind you'd see on a hiker or beach-goer. But hidden in plain sight is a flexible solar panel sewn right into the brim. This panel absorbs sunlight, converting it into usable power that charges your devices via a USB-C port tucked discreetly in the inner band.
